#34463a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34463a is composed of 20.4% red, 27.5%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 14.8% and a lightness of 23.9%. #34463a color hex could be obtained by blending #688c74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#34463a color description : Very dark grayish cyan - lime green.
#34463a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34463a has RGB values of R:52, G:70,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 3425850.
